310 CMR 15.281 - Purpose

(1) Alternative systems, when properly designed, constructed, operated and maintained, may provide enhanced protection of public health, safety, welfare and the environment. The purposes of 310 CMR 15.281 through 15.288 are: to provide an orderly system to facilitate review of proposed alternative systems; to encourage development of alternative systems with performance superior to conventional systems; and to ensure that alternative systems are approved with appropriate conditions to protect public health, safety, welfare and the environment.
(2) The provisions of 310 CMR 15.281 through 15.288 shall apply to all proposals to construct, upgrade, or replace on-site systems using alternative systems.
(3) Any proposed system which is designed or constructed in any manner other than as described in 310 CMR 15.100 through 15.262 shall be considered an alternative system, unless a groundwater discharge permit is obtained pursuant to 314 CMR 5.00 (groundwater discharge permit program). Alternative systems may include substitutes or alternatives for one or more components of a conventional system as described in 310 CMR 15.100 through 15.262, or may be fundamentally different approaches intended to eliminate the need for a conventional system. The use of an alternative system in accordance with conditions established pursuant to 310 CMR 15.281 through 15.289 may be authorized without a variance. It shall be a violation of 310 CMR 15.000 for any person to sell or install an alternative system which has not been approved by the Department.
(4) The review processes established in 310 CMR 15.280 through 15.288 are intended to provide two different mechanisms for approval of alternative systems. Approval for remedial use (310 CMR 15.284) is intended to provide a mechanism for system owners to improve existing conditions at particular sites (including upgrade or replacement of failed or nonconforming systems) through the use of an alternative system. The sequence of approval for piloting (310 CMR 15.285), provisional approval (310 CMR 15.286), and certification for general use (310 CMR 15.288), is intended to provide a process through which proponents of an alternative system may have that system approved for general usage in the Commonwealth, including use for new construction. This sequence is intended to develop information on the performance of the alternative system; if adequate information from other jurisdictions or from systems in remedial use is available, it is unnecessary to proceed separately through all three steps of this sequence.
